Cataract: why colours look faded

The new wall paint looked friendly and fresh in the shop. At home on the wall, the same shade suddenly appears dull and yellow-tinged. Behind irritations like these, it is sometimes not the lighting but your own eye. Cataract (a clouding of the eye’s natural lens) changes not only the sharpness of vision but also the perception of colour. The clouding lens settles over the image like a yellowish filter.

This article explains why colour vision changes with cataract, which forms of lens clouding shift colours most strongly and what you can expect after the operation.

Why the clouded lens changes colours

The healthy lens of the eye is largely clear. With cataract it discolours, particularly in the common form with clouding in the lens core. This clouding often takes on a yellowish to brownish tint. Light has to pass through this filter before it reaches the retina.

Blue and violet tones are filtered out more strongly than warm tones such as yellow or red. The whole of vision thereby takes on a slightly yellow-tinged overall cast. This process unfolds so slowly that it often goes unnoticed in everyday life for a long time. The brain gradually gets used to the altered colour impression and compensates for it unconsciously.

Which form of cataract shifts colours most strongly?

Cataract does not develop the same way in everyone. In the most common form, nuclear cataract, it is above all the lens core that clouds over with a yellowish to brownish tint. This form changes colour perception particularly clearly, since all incoming light has to pass through the discoloured core.

Other forms behave differently. In cortical cataract, spoke-shaped opacities develop in the outer zone of the lens. They mainly cause glare and scattered light; the colour shift is usually smaller. Much the same applies to subcapsular cataract at the back of the lens: here too, glare sensitivity and reading difficulties dominate rather than altered colours.

During the examination with the slit lamp, a special microscope for the eye, your ophthalmologist can tell which form is present. That also explains why some patients report a strong colour shift while others barely notice one.

How those affected describe the change

Many people only notice the altered colour perception in hindsight, after the operation. Common descriptions include:

  • “White paper looked slightly yellowish before; now it is brilliantly white.”
  • “Blues come out much more intensely now than they used to.”
  • “I had no idea how much the colours had changed.”
  • “It feels as if I had taken off a pair of tinted glasses.”

This realisation almost always arrives only after the procedure. Beforehand, the creeping loss of colour intensity is hardly possible to sense consciously.

A typical example from practice: some patients only notice the change when buying new clothes or wall paint. The shade chosen in the shop suddenly looks different at home under familiar lighting. When comparing photos taken before and after the operation, too, many only spot the difference in direct comparison.

Is altered colour vision a warning sign on its own?

Paler-looking colours alone do not yet justify an urgent assessment. Combined with other signs, however, the picture becomes clearer. Watch additionally for blurred vision, glare sensitivity or frequent changes of glasses. If several of these symptoms appear together, that points to a progressing cataract.

An eye examination with the slit lamp reliably establishes whether a clouding of the lens is present. Other causes of altered colour vision, such as certain retinal conditions, can be ruled out at the same time. Do not put off the appointment until your vision is clearly restricted in everyday life.

Colour vision after the operation

After the clouded lens has been replaced with a clear artificial lens, many patients report a distinctly stronger impression of colour. White looks whiter, blues appear more luminous. Some find this unusually intense at first, but get used to it within a few days.

Some artificial lenses deliberately filter out a small share of the blue light spectrum, similar to the natural, slightly yellowish lens. That makes for natural vision without losing this filter effect entirely. Clear artificial lenses without this filter, by contrast, let more blue light through and tend to be used in younger patients. Which version suits you is something you discuss with your ophthalmologist as part of the preliminary examination.

Frequently asked questions

Do you notice yourself that colours are fading?

Usually not directly, since the change happens very slowly. Many only notice it in hindsight, after the operation.

Do colours become unnaturally garish after surgery?

No, vision becomes more natural, not artificially boosted. The yellowish filter of the clouded lens simply falls away.

Does the colour change affect both eyes equally?

Not necessarily. Cataract often develops at different speeds in the two eyes, so the colour shift can be stronger on one side.

How quickly does colour perception change after the operation?

Many patients notice the stronger colour impression on the very first day after surgery. It takes several weeks, though, for vision to stabilise completely.
